Job description

We are currently seeking a Section Engineer / Sub Agent to work for a Civil Contractor who works across the UK specializing in a variety of Civil/marine/environmental engineering sectors with a primary focus on marine and flood defence. Role will be based in Hampshire with the candidate expected to travel intermittently across the Southern region.


Responsibilities:
  1. Support the Project Manager in the execution of their duties and management of smaller construction contracts.
  2. Management of site staff operatives and sub-contractors.
  3. Provide method statements, hazard risk assessments, and project management plans.
  4. Understand tender allowances and monitor contract costs against agreed budgets.
  5. Preparing and monitoring programme of work.
  6. Assessment and engagement of sub-contractors.
  7. Manage design co-ordination.
  8. Manage contracts to ensure timely and profitable completion of contracts.
  9. Inform, consult, and involve local groups as necessary.
  10. Maintain good relations and reputation with clients.

You should be:
  1. A good communicator with the ability to instruct and direct staff.
  2. A good organiser, both of self and others, with the ability to think in advance.
  3. Experienced in people management and motivation of staff.
